An advanced life cycle is denoted by in the Life Cycle Template Administration utility.

The advanced life cycle type provides the ability for a separate team to be assigned for instances of this object type and to include workflow process definitions within the life cycle states to manage the maturing of the object type. Use this type for managing objects that require company-specific business processes, special access control requirements, or additional flexibility in managing these types of objects.

Managing Life Cycle Processes

In Windchill, the life cycle is the core capability to manage an object's maturity (referred to as a life cycle state) as well as access control policies to manage or view the object for a set of roles in the system. Each object type in a Windchill system can have unique sets of life cycle states and access control policies. Object initiation rules are used to designate which life cycle an object is assigned when a user creates a new object of that type. Workflows can be used to manage the maturing processes from state to state through workflow activity templates. By default, when new versions of an object are created through the Revise action, the life cycle state is set to the first state of the life cycle. A life cycle administrator can specify the target state of the Revise action.

Depending on several business environment considerations (impact of change, development team, maturity of object, type of object, and so forth), it may be important to tailor the life cycle to include certain business operations and to define how these operations are executed.

For example, a development team in the automotive division of a company can have different review processes for releasing a design specification than the industrial products division. The automotive division may require a prototype to be created for a new product before the first production versions of the product are released. Formal change processes are required to update these prototype designs.

After a part has been initially released to production, new versions of the design are designated as Production Change, and they must undergo a formal change process.

Windchill PDMLink supports the following business processes that you can use to manage the life cycle of a part, document, or CAD document. You can use transition rules to control when in the life cycle this operation is available. For example:

Set State - Enables you to informally set the life cycle state of an object.

Promote - Enables you to set the state of one or more objects to a new life cycle state as part of a review process.

Change - Enables you to execute a change order for a product development object.

Revise - Enables you to create a new version of the object.
